Overview
The HP 15-ef2024nr Ryzen 3 Laptop is a straightforward, no-nonsense machine built for people who need a dependable daily driver without spending a lot. What sets it apart from the bottom of the budget pile is the AMD Ryzen 3 5300U processor — a genuine four-core chip that handles everyday tasks far more capably than the aging Celeron or Pentium options still lurking in this price range. The chassis comes in a Natural Silver finish that looks quietly professional, and at 3.75 lbs it travels easily in a bag. Just be clear going in: this is a capable workhorse for basics, not a machine you would push with heavy editing or gaming.
Features & Benefits
The core hardware tells a decent story for the price. The NVMe SSD storage means the machine boots in seconds and opens applications without the painful lag you get from spinning-disk budget laptops. Paired with 8 GB of DDR4 RAM, everyday multitasking — a dozen browser tabs, a document, a video call — stays manageable. The 15.6-inch display is where the honest conversation starts: it gets the job done for documents and streaming, but the 1366x768 resolution will look noticeably softer than rivals now shipping 1080p panels at comparable prices. Connectivity is practical with three USB 3.0 ports, Bluetooth, and Wi-Fi, and the HP Fast Charge feature helps recover battery quickly when you are short on time.

User Feedback
Owners of this entry-level HP machine tend to land in two camps pretty quickly. On the positive side, people consistently mention fast boot times and note that the keyboard feels more comfortable than expected for something in this price range — small things that genuinely matter during long study or work sessions. The criticisms are predictable but worth knowing: the display resolution draws the most complaints, with buyers noting it looks noticeably soft next to newer competitors. Storage fills up faster than many users anticipated, so pairing with an external drive is practically essential. Real-world battery life also tends to fall short of the rated ceiling, with most users reporting five to six hours under typical use.

Not suitable for:
The HP 15-ef2024nr Ryzen 3 Laptop is not the right call if your work or entertainment regularly pushes beyond everyday tasks. Video editors, photographers working in Lightroom, or anyone running multiple demanding applications simultaneously will hit the limits of the Ryzen 3 chip and integrated graphics faster than they might expect. The 1366x768 display is a real sticking point for anyone who cares about screen sharpness — competing budget laptops now routinely offer full HD panels at comparable prices, and the difference is immediately visible. With only 256 GB of storage and what appears to be a single RAM slot, the long-term upgrade path is narrow, which matters if you plan to keep the machine for more than two or three years. Gamers should look elsewhere entirely, as the integrated AMD Radeon graphics can only handle the lightest casual titles.
Specifications
- Processor: Powered by an AMD Ryzen 3 5300U with 4 cores and a boost clock of up to 3.8 GHz.
- RAM: Includes 8 GB of DDR4-3200 MHz memory installed in a single SO-DIMM slot.
- Storage: Equipped with a 256 GB PCIe NVMe M.2 SSD for fast system and application load times.
- Display: Features a 15.6-inch HD (1366x768) BrightView micro-edge panel with slim bezels on three sides.
- Graphics: Uses integrated AMD Radeon graphics that share system memory with the processor.
- Operating System: Ships with Windows 11 Home pre-installed, ready to use out of the box.
- Battery: Rated at up to 7 hours and 15 minutes of use, with HP Fast Charge technology supported.
- Webcam: Includes a 720p HD camera positioned above the display for video calls and conferencing.
- Wireless: Supports 802.11a Wi-Fi and Bluetooth for wireless device and network connectivity.
- Ports: Provides three USB 3.0 ports for connecting peripherals, external drives, and accessories.
- Weight: Weighs 3.75 lbs (approximately 1.7 kg), making it practical for daily bag carry.
- Dimensions: Measures 14.11 x 8.05 x 0.71 inches, fitting comfortably in a standard 15-inch laptop sleeve.
- Color: Available in a Natural Silver finish that gives the chassis a clean, understated appearance.
- Optical Drive: Does not include an optical drive; a separate external unit is required for any disc media.
